| 20100272499 | ENVIRONMENTALLY FRIENDLY DISPOSABLE PEN - An ecological friendly disposable pen includes a main housing, a plug, a cap, an ink reservoir set within the main housing, and a nib sub-assembly. The nib sub-assembly may include a nib, which provides the writing end of the pen, and a wick, which carries ink from the reservoir to the nib. The plug plugs one end of the main housing, and the nib sub-assembly is set within the other end of the main housing. The ink reservoir stores a non-toxic ink. The plug, cap, ink reservoir and main housing are all formed from biodegradable, non-toxic materials. | 10-28-2010 |
| 20110123251 | CASING FOR A WRITING INSTRUMENT AND METHOD OF MANUFACTURING THE SAME USING A DUAL INJECTION MOLDING - A casing for a writing instrument comprises an outer shaft, an inner shaft, and a nib. The outer shaft is formed using dual injection molding. An outer surface of the outer shaft includes a raised hard part and a raised soft part. The inner shaft is formed of a thin-wall tube having an upper end and a lower end, the inner shaft being configured for insertion inside the outer shaft. The inner shaft further includes a fastener protruding on its upper end that engages an upper end of the outer shaft. The nib is configured to engage the lower end of the inner shaft to help secure the inner shaft within the outer shaft. The raised hard or soft parts on the outer surface of the outer shaft may include an oblique loop-shaped part, a strip-shaped part, and/or an arc-shaped part. | 05-26-2011 |
| 20100008711 | DRY ERASE INK FOR NON-POROUS SURFACES - A dry-erase ink is disclosed for writing or marking on glossy and non-porous surfaces, in particular whiteboards or dry-erase boards, which ink is wipeable or erasable after drying without leaving visible colored residues. The ink contains a solvent, one or more dye(s) soluble in the solvent, a film forming resin such as polyvinylpyrrolidone or a derivative thereof, a strongly-alkaline substance such as a diamine and/or a quaternary organic ammonium hydroxide, an organic acid or a salt thereof and, if desired, a nonvolatile, liquid component serving as a release agent. | 01-14-2010 |

| 20120057924 | CONICAL NIB AND WRITING INSTRUMENT USING THE SAME - A nib piece with high roundness is obtained in the following manner: in the forming of the nib piece, a punched hole is formed in a base portion of a punched plate which is to be bent; the base portion of the punched plate is bent and shaped into a tubular structure; a pipe member which is aligned with and accommodated in the tubular body, is disposed in an inner portion of the base portion of the punched plate having been bent; and the punched plate is shaped to obtain a structure to wrap an outer periphery of the pipe member. The punched plate includes an engageable joint portion, such as a protrusion and a recess, which engage each other and form a hooked edge when the punched plate is bent into a cylindrical form. | 03-08-2012 |

| 20130064597 | WRITING INSTRUMENT AND INK CARTRIDGE UNIT - A writing instrument includes a shell, an ink reservoir disposed in the shell and a writing tip section that is provided on the shell from which ink from the ink reservoir is applied to a substrate. The writing tip section includes a writing tip and an ink feed assembly for delivering ink from the ink reservoir to the writing tip through capillary action. The writing tip is flexible and a flexible cover with the shape of a fountain pen nib is provided for supporting the flexible writing tip. | 03-14-2013 |

| 20110274478 | CONICAL NIB AND WRITING INSTRUMENT INCORPORATING THE SAME - A nib of a writing instrument is made of a carbon-resin mixture obtained by mixing a plastic material with carbon fiber. An ink feed core is provided with a nib cover. The nib cover is disposed on an outer periphery of the ink feed core between the nib and the ink feed core. The nib cover is configured to closely adhere at least to an inner periphery of the nib at the tip of the nib. A space defined between the nib and the ink feed core is filled up with the nib cover. The nib is made of a carbon-resin mixture obtained by mixing a plastic material with carbon fiber. With this configuration, a nib having high wear resistance can be obtained and duration of the nib and the writing instrument can be prolonged. | 11-10-2011 |

| 20120107036 | WRITING PEN WITH INK STORAGE - A writing pen with ink storage is provided, including a writing nib, an ink storage compartment for storing ink, an ink inducing device for inducing ink into the writing nib, wherein the writing pen further includes an air pressure balancing plug which is plugged in an open end of the ink storage compartment to seal ink, and a breathable core having nanopores, the breathable core being inserted into the air pressure balancing plug with one end extending into ink and the other end communicating with ambient air. The writing pen with ink storage of the present patent application has simple structure, provides fluent writing and no ink leakage. | 05-03-2012 |

| 20090297250 | PEN CAP AND PEN BARREL COUPLING STRUCTURE - A pen cap and a pen barrel coupling structure provides the pen cap formed in hollow to hold a magnet and an opening at one end and the pen barrel couplable with the opening of the pen cap and having a metal element attractable to the magnet. The pen cap and pen barrel have respectively a first coupling portion and a second coupling portion that correspond to and engageable with each other. The first and second coupling portions form a first coupling position to allow the magnet and metal element attracting to each other to form an anchor condition, and a second coupling position to separate the magnet and metal element to release the anchor condition. Thus by moving the pen cap against the pen barrel to the second coupling position, the pen cap can be separated from the pen barrel to make use of the pen easier. | 12-03-2009 |
